1. Experience the Sunrise Together at Sarangkot, Pokhara:

Kickstart your romantic journey with an early morning trip to Sarangkot, a hilltop near Pokhara famous for its breathtaking sunrise views. As the first rays of sunlight illuminate the Annapurna and Dhaulagiri ranges, hold your partner close and soak in the magical scenery. The tranquil atmosphere and panoramic vistas make it a perfect spot for quiet moments of reflection and connection.

2. Go Boating on Phewa Lake:

Nothing spells romance like a leisurely boat ride on Phewa Lake in Pokhara. Rent a brightly painted wooden boat and glide across the calm waters while enjoying the views of the surrounding hills and the iconic Tal Barahi Temple located on an island in the lake. Pack a picnic to make the experience even more memorable.

3. Take a Hot Air Balloon Ride in Kathmandu Valley:

For couples seeking a touch of adventure, a hot air balloon ride over Kathmandu Valley is a must. As you float high above the bustling city, admire the patchwork of ancient temples, green fields, and snow-capped peaks. It’s an exhilarating experience that offers both serenity and a dash of adrenaline.

4. Stay at a Luxury Resort in Nagarkot:

Treat yourselves to a romantic stay at a luxury resort in Nagarkot, a hill station known for its panoramic views of the Himalayas. Many resorts offer private balconies or terraces where you can sip your morning coffee while watching the sun rise over Mount Everest. Enjoy spa treatments, candlelit dinners, and stargazing nights with your loved one.

5. Explore the Old World Charm of Bhaktapur:

Step back in time as you wander through the ancient streets of Bhaktapur, a UNESCO World Heritage site. The medieval architecture, intricate woodwork, and vibrant culture make it a perfect place to explore hand in hand. Don’t miss indulging in local treats like “Juju Dhau” (king curd) for a sweet ending to your visit.

6. Go Trekking Together in the Annapurna Region:

For couples who love adventure, trekking in the Annapurna region is a dream come true. Choose shorter, less strenuous trails like the Ghorepani Poon Hill trek, which offers stunning views and charming villages along the way. The shared challenges and triumphs of trekking will bring you closer together.

7. Witness the Romance of the Garden of Dreams:

Escape the hustle and bustle of Kathmandu and step into the serene Garden of Dreams. This beautifully landscaped neo-classical garden is perfect for a romantic stroll, complete with fountains, pavilions, and blooming flowers. Find a quiet corner to relax and enjoy each other’s company amidst the tranquil surroundings.

8. Indulge in a Couple’s Spa Day:

Pamper yourselves with a rejuvenating spa experience at one of Nepal’s renowned wellness centers. Many spas offer couple’s packages that include relaxing massages, herbal baths, and aromatherapy sessions. It’s the perfect way to unwind and connect on a deeper level.

9. Visit the Peaceful Rara Lake:

Nestled in the remote northwest of Nepal, Rara Lake is a pristine paradise ideal for couples looking to escape the crowds. The azure waters, surrounded by dense forests and snow-capped peaks, create a magical setting. Plan a camping trip or enjoy a quiet picnic by the lakeside for a truly intimate experience.

10. Attend a Traditional Nepalese Festival:

Immerse yourselves in Nepal’s vibrant culture by participating in a traditional festival. Whether it’s the colorful Holi celebrations, the grandeur of Dashain, or the spiritual Tihar festival, these events offer a unique opportunity to connect with the local culture and create lasting memories with your partner.
